The first book to recover the Indigenous aesthetic principles that guided how artists of the Aztec Empire created precious art
For the Nahua people of the Aztec Empire, precious things such as feathers, stones, and gold—known in the Nahuatl language as tlazohtli—were central to their understanding of the material world and their place in it.
